Climate Impact on Water Storage
Dubai’s hot and arid climate creates unique challenges for water storage. High temperatures can accelerate the growth of bacteria and algae inside water tanks, especially when water remains stagnant for long periods. This not only affects water quality but also increases the risk of health issues if the contaminated water is used for drinking or daily household purposes.
Property-Specific Concerns
Water tank maintenance requirements vary depending on the type of property. High-rise buildings often have multiple interconnected tanks located in hard-to-reach areas. Shared systems between apartments mean that if even one tank is neglected, it can affect the water quality for multiple residents. Proper inspection and cleaning schedules are essential to prevent contamination across the building.

Sediment and Rust Accumulation
Hard water, corrosion, and aging tank materials often cause sediment and rust to build up at the bottom of water tanks. This accumulation can make the water appear cloudy and affect its taste, while also increasing the likelihood of clogged pipes and plumbing issues. Over time, neglected sediment can reduce water flow and put additional strain on pumps and filtration systems, making regular cleaning essential for maintaining water quality.
Bacterial and Algae Growth
Stagnant water in tanks provides an ideal environment for bacteria and algae to grow. These harmful microbes can contaminate the water, posing health risks such as gastrointestinal infections or skin irritations for residents, tenants, or employees. Regular cleaning, disinfection, and proper circulation of water are necessary to prevent these microbial problems and ensure a safe water supply.
Cracks, Leaks, and Structural Damage
Water tanks can develop cracks or leaks over time due to wear and tear, poor installation, or extreme weather conditions. Signs may include reduced water pressure, visible cracks, or unexplained water loss. Structural damage not only wastes water but can also lead to costly property repairs if left unaddressed, making timely inspection and professional repair crucial.
Poor Ventilation and Tank Design Flaws
Tanks with limited airflow or poorly designed structures are more prone to odor, algae, and bacterial growth. Inadequate ventilation prevents the water from circulating properly, which accelerates contamination. Proper tank design, including vents and lids that keep dust and debris out, is essential to maintain hygiene and water quality.
Faulty Plumbing Connections
Improper or damaged plumbing connections can lead to cross-contamination, even if the tank itself is clean. Leaks, backflow, or poorly fitted pipes can allow contaminants to enter the water supply. Ensuring that plumbing is correctly installed and regularly inspected is critical for maintaining safe, reliable water throughout the property.
